About Chhencha

Chhencha is a rural settlement in Barwadih, Latehar, Jharkhand. It has a population of 2,862 in about 622 households (avg size: 4.6). Approximate literacy: 49.9%.

Population of Chhencha

Population (Total)2,862
Male1,427
Female1,435
Children (0–6 years)567
Households622
Literate persons1,428
Illiterate persons1,434
Total workers985
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)1006
Literacy (approx.)49.9%
SC population622
ST population1,010
